Alber Elbaz
The Moroccan-born Israeli fashion designer Alber Elbaz (born in 1961) is the creative director of the French fashion house Lanvin. In 1998, Elbaz began designing ready-to-wear women’s clothing for Yves Saint Laurent. In the position, Elbaz’s talent was recognized, and he was groomed to become the head designer of the house when Saint Laurent retired. After several changes of the ownership, the fashion house of Lanvin went finally to Alber Elbaz in October 2001. Since then, he is the artistic director for all activities, including interiors, and he has conducted his responsibilities in a highly personal, hands-on manner.
